In August 1944, Private Margaret Hicks of the ATS (Auxiliary Territorial Service), from Sparkbrook, Birmingham, a member of a mixed anti-aircraft battery on the South Coast, paints another V-1 'kill' on the battery scoreboard.

At 18 years old, Private Hicks is the youngest member of her battery, and formerly worked as a shop assistant.

The V-1 flying bomb (nicknamed "doodle bug" in Britain) was the first of the Vergeltungswaffen (V-weapons) deployed for the terror bombing of London during .

The Wehrmacht first launched the V-1s against London on 13 June 1944, one week after (and prompted by) the successful Allied landings in France.

At peak, more than one hundred V-1s a day were fired at southeast England (9,521 in total) decreasing in number as sites were overrun until October 1944, when the last V-1 site in range of Britain was overrun by Allied forces.

On 9 August 1944, men of the Durham Light Infantry (DLI) are pictured moving up during the fighting south of Mont Pincon, Normandy. Heavy mortar fire greeted their advance, as they pushed forward with the tanks along the high ground.

Writing after the end of , Field Marshal Bernard Montgomery said, "Of all the infantry regiments in the British Army, the DLI was one most closely associated with myself during the war. The DLI Brigade [151st Brigade] fought under my command from Alamein to Germany... It is a magnificent regiment. Steady as a rock in battle and absolutely reliable on all occasions. The fighting men of Durham are splendid soldiers; they excel in the hard-fought battle and they always stick it out to the end; they have gained their objectives and held their positions even when all their officers have been killed and condition were almost unendurable."
